Ever since 2010 when season one grabbed the enormous viewing audience it did I have been one Irish blooded woman who spent my Friday nights enthralled with the acting talent and well written story lines that are found in each and every episode of Blue Bloods. From Len Cariou (Henry Reagan), elder family statesman and former NYPD Commissioner we follow the interesting lives of each Reagan on down to the youngest (Danny Reagan's boys).
Tom Selleck (Frank Reagan) is now NYPD Commissioner and that's a lot of responsibility to juggle while also keeping his family running smoothly. Dinner time is (for me) the highlight of each episode when all the family gather around a huge dining room table and discuss their day. Good old fashioned values combined with action and sometimes danger on the wild and crazy streets of New York City make this a superb hour of television. Now I'm hunting down each season to have for my very own!
